Lourdes lost both ends of its doubleheader with Madonna on Saturday afternoon, falling 12-5 and 5-3 in 10 innings at Mercy Field.
Â
In the opener, the Crusaders jumped in front fast, scoring four runs in both the first and third innings. Madonna added to the lead with a run in the sixth and three in the seventh to take a 12-0 advantage.
Â
Nate Blain kept the Gray Wolves off the board through six innings, allowing just two hits while striking out five.
Â
Lourdes broke through against the Madonna bullpen in the seventh, scoring five times.Â
Harrison Jackson (Millbury, Ohio/Lake H.S.) drove home the first run before
Ryan Jagodzinski (Perrysburg, Ohio/Rossford H.S.) delivered a bases clearing triple for his third hit of the game.Â
Joel Suraganan (Pickerington, Ont./Dunbarton H.S.) followed with a RBI hit, closing out the Gray Wolf scoring.
Â
Steve Haugh (Waterville, Ohio/Anthony Wayne H.S.) broke a scoreless tie to lead off the fourth inning of game two, hitting his fifth home run of the season. Suraganan doubled home a run in the fifth and scored two batters later on a Haugh sacrifice fly as the Gray Wolves increased the lead to 3-0.
Â
Madonna tied the game in the sixth with a pair of home runs and the game stayed deadlocked until the 10
th. Three straight hits by the Crusaders drove home what would be the two game-winning runs.
Â
Jagodzinski, Haugh, and
Hunter Mix (Swanton, Ohio/Swanton H.S.) each had two-hit games in the nightcap.
Â
Lourdes (20-24, 15-15 WHAC) and Madonna (28-15, 22-6) will close out the weekend series, and the regular season, on Sunday afternoon. Game one of the doubleheader is set for 1 p.m. with Senior Day activities taking place prior to the game.
